Statement of Volatility – Dell PowerEdge M520
Systems
The Dell PowerEdge M520 system contains both volatile and non-volatile (NV) components. Volatile components lose their
data immediately after power is removed from the component. Non-volatile (NV) components continue to retain their data
even after power is removed from the component. The following NV components are present on the M520 system.
